The role of Operations Leadership team member at Drury Hotels is integral to the overall success and smooth operation of the hotel. This leadership position requires a dynamic individual who thrives in a fast-paced environment and is committed to delivering an exceptional guest experience. As a leader, you will oversee all hotel departments, ensuring that service quality and operational standards are consistently met or exceeded. You will have direct responsibility for coaching, training, and developing team members, enabling them to perform their duties effectively and gain valuable skills. Your leadership will also directly impact key business metrics such as quality, service delivery, profitability, and team engagement, making this a highly influential role within the hotel.

As part of the company’s core values, this position promotes a culture of excellence, teamwork, and mutual respect. The ideal candidate demonstrates a passion for serving others and possesses a strong desire to exceed guest expectations at every opportunity. A bachelor's degree in hospitality, business, or a related field is preferred, alongside a minimum of one year of supervisory experience that showcases proven leadership abilities. Previous experience in the hotel industry is also advantageous.
